导言
近来许多tpwallet用户发现钱包界面经常“多出”一些代币、余额或未知资产条目。表面上看是资产增加,但背后既有技术与市场因素,也隐藏安全与合规风险。本文梳理成因、涉及的实时数据与高效能技术趋势,并探讨如何通过智能化数据平台与个性化资产管理策略来降低风险、提升体验,最后特别谈及比特现金(Bitcoin Cash,BCH)的相关影响。
一、“多出币”的主要成因

1. 空投与营销代币:项目方频繁空投或向链上地址广播代币,会导致钱包自动显示新代币。很多是价值极低的“垃圾代币”。
2. 链上分叉与历史快照:如比特/比特现金等历史分叉会在持币者地址上产生分叉链资产,若钱包支持多个链,可能会显示分叉链上的余额。
3. 代币合约部署与模仿:同名或相似合约地址、代币元数据混淆,使钱包展示多个看似相同的代币。
4. 中间合约/包装资产(wrapped token):跨链桥、包装合约会在原链外生成对应代币,使资产显示增加。
5. 垃圾交易与“dusting”攻击:攻击者向大量地址转小额代币以追踪或制造混淆,钱包会显示这些条目。
6. 钱包展示策略:部分钱包默认显示链上所有代币余额(包括0余额或非标准代币),导致列表冗长。
二、实时数据管理要点
1. 实时索引与去重:应对新代币产生与合约映射,实时索引交易与合约事件,依据合约地址和符号去重与校验元数据来源。
2. 元数据验证:建立可信的代币元数据源(链上/链下双源对照),引入签名或社区信任度来避免伪造名称与符号。
3. 数据流处理:采用流式处理(如Kafka/ Pulsar + 流式ETL)实时消费区块事件,保证新代币展示的时效性与一致性。
4. 可审计的变更历史:记录代币第一次出现、来源交易与时间,方便追踪与合规审计。
三、高效能科技趋势(对钱包与数据平台的影响)
1. 边缘计算与WebSocket/Push:用WebSocket与推送服务减少客户端轮询,提高实时性与节省资源。
2. 高性能索引服务:借助Rust、C++或调优的Go服务构建轻量级索引器(参考The Graph、Indexer架构)。
3. 向量检索与实体匹配:利用向量数据库做相似合约/代币名检测,快速识别模仿代币。
4. WASM与可插拔组件:用WASM实现安全的链上事件解析插件,支持多链扩展。
5. 隐私计算与差分隐私:在个性化服务中保护用户敏感指标,合规处理审计需求。
四、市场预测与风险识别方法
1. 链上指标建模:结合持币集中度、流动性、最近交易活跃度判断代币的真实价值与传播热度。
2. 异常检测:通过时间序列模型(ARIMA、Transformer-based)与异常检测算法识别突发大量空投或进出账模式。
3. 多模态情绪与事件驱动预测:结合社媒情绪、公告与 on-chain 信号预测代币价格或被标记为垃圾代币的概率。
4. BCH相关预测:监测 BCH 链上波动、分叉事件或跨链桥活动,因为重大事件会引发大量小额转账与代币生成,导致钱包“多出”异常条目。
五、智能化数据平台架构建议
1. 事件总线层:区块/交易/合约事件的统一接入,支持多链插件。
2. 实时处理层:流处理与规则引擎,对代币新增事件做即时分类(可信/可疑/垃圾)。
3. 特征与风险库:维护代币评分(流动性、持币分布、合约审计、历史表现),供前端决策和推荐使用。
4. 可视化与审计:为用户与合规团队提供可溯源的“代币出现链路”视图。
六、个性化资产管理策略
1. 用户策略与过滤:允许用户自定义“自动隐藏未知代币”“只显示有流动性的代币”“自动归并同名代币”等策略。
2. 风险分层与建议:基于用户风险偏好,自动标注并分层展示安全、关注与屏蔽资产,并给出操作建议(忽略、隐藏、移除UI或销毁/回收提示)。
3. 自动化操作:提供一键“清理界面”功能(仅影响展示,不影响链上资产),在必要时引导用户将资产安全转出(sweep)到新地址。
4. 税务与合规管理:识别空投/赠与并生成报告,支持不同司法辖区的合规需求。
七、比特现金(BCH)专题说明
1. 分叉遗留:BCH作为从比特币分叉的链,历史上导致分叉时持币者在对方链上出现相应余额。这类“多出币”与空投不同,是链分叉的正常结果,但需注意不能随意在不受信链上签名操作以避免重放攻击。
2. 跨链桥与包装资产:BCH与其他链的互操作可能生成包装代币,从而在钱包中显示额外资产条目。
3. 风险点:部分BCH生态的代币市场深度有限,容易被列为低流动性或高风险代币,钱包应为用户标注并提供清理建议。
八、用户安全与产品实践建议
1. 不要对未知合约签名或授权可疑代币转移权限。
2. 提供默认“隐藏低价值/垃圾代币”配置,并允许用户手动开启完整显示。
3. 对新出现代币提供来源与风险评分链接,帮助用户判断是否可信。

4. 对于可能源于分叉的资产,向用户说明如何安全地提取或处理,并提示重放保护与私钥风险。
结语
tpwallet等轻钱包面对“多出币”问题既是体验问题也是安全与合规问题。采用实时数据管理、以高性能索引与智能化平台为基础,结合个性化资产管理策略,可以在提高用户体验的同时降低风险。对BCH等分叉链与跨链资产需有专门识别与提示逻辑,最终目标是让用户在明确来源与风险的前提下,安全、可控地管理自己的链上资产。
评论
Crypto小白
这篇文章把多出币的技术与用户策略讲得很清晰,尤其是关于自动隐藏和风险评分的建议,值得钱包开发参考。
Ethan_88
关于BCH的分叉解释很到位,尤其提醒了重放攻击风险,普通用户很容易忽视。
链上观测者
希望tpwallet能尽快上线类似的实时检测与清理功能,垃圾代币太碍眼也影响使用体验。
敏捷工程师
技术部分提到的流式处理与向量检索很实用,可作为工程实现路线图的一部分。